Output d21870395b0066631fd6162623488687ad589e0a68e7942145d2473c95961c4e:0

value
3150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 218980dedf8babca31e264c843beaaf3314d7161 OP_EQUALVERIFY OP_CHECKSIG
address
144L2EanWQ4W2BEQ5SwBnZzRJVJMSPumUv
transaction
d21870395b0066631fd6162623488687ad589e0a68e7942145d2473c95961c4e
spent
true